“Bad Vegan” Sarma Melngailis has filed for divorce from her estranged spouse Anthony Strangis – two years after cops caught up to them when they ordered from Domino’s while hiding out at a $99-a-night Tennessee motel.
Melngailis, 45, and Strangis, 37, were on the lam to evade angry investors in her celeb-friendly vegan restaurant Pure Food and Wine after swiping $2 million from the company to blow on Rolex watches and European vacations.
Melngailis blamed Strangis – a 275-pound ex-con – for placing the fateful order of wings and pizza that tipped off cops. The svelte blonde insisted she was still a devout vegan.
Her Gramercy eatery – which drew celeb diners like Woody Harrelson and Alec Baldwin – shuttered in 2015 after Melngailis went AWOL that summer leaving unpaid staff in the lurch.
When they were busted, Melngailis claimed she was divorcing Strangis, who had a criminal record and gambling problem. But she just filed for the split last week more than six months after being freed from Rikers on fraud and grand larceny charges.
Meanwhile Strangis is one year into a five-year probation period for failing to pay sales tax and stiffing restaurant staffers.
The split is uncontested, meaning they don’t expected a legal battle.
That’s likely because they have nothing to fight over. The couple didn’t have children and they must repay the money they stole from investors as a condition of their guilty pleas.
